I don't know about ancient times (like back in the days of MM v1.1) but the
databases today are stored off the home directory of mailman (generally:
/home/mailman/lists/<listname>/....).  If you look at the commands that come
with Mailman you will find several that can be of help to you:
  list_members
  dumpdb

To get "list_members" to work, you may have to move the directory structure
so that the lists once again hang off of the home directory of the user
Mailman.

> I recently had to completely reformat my primary harddrive and reinstall
> Linux from scratch.  I had to do this because someone hacked into my box
and
> messed everything up.  The admins at my datacenter did the reinstall and
now
> my system is back up.
>
> The good news is that I have a second disk in the machine that is a backup
> of the primary disk so I have a backup of ALL my files.  Now I am
> reinstalling everything from scratch including Mailman.  I was using
Mailman
> 1.1.  Now I am installing Mailman 2.1.  I was managing several mailing
lists
> for my customers using Mailman 1.1.
>
> My question:
> How can I retrieve all the emails for the old mailing lists?  I have all
the
> files but have not been able to locate the "database" that contains all
the
> email addresses for each mailing list.  I would like to install and
> configure Mailman 2.1 and recreate the mailing lists.  Then I want to
> retrieve all the email addresses from the old files/"databases" and import
> them into the new mailing lists.  Can this be done?  I hope so since my
> customers have lists with thousands of email addresses and there is no way
> for me to recreate the list of addresses unless I can retrieve them from
the
> old backup files.
